Tips to Burning Fat
   
           
     
 

Former Surgeon General C.Everett Koop said about obesity: "Obesity represents the consequences of a mismatch between intake and energy expenditure.

Because hard physical labor is no longer required ofus, maen and women living in industrialized societies must reduce their intkae of fofod in oredre to match their sedentary lifestyles.

The energy expenditure of the averagea American laborer is half of that demanded at the turn of the century, when the labor force was predominantly agricultural. Decreasing calorie intake to match a drastically reduced energy expenditure is a formidable challenge t many of us , but not all of us."

There are however a many treatment suggestions for fighting obesity. But about the most positive solution is to stick to a good exercise and a good diet plan from which you may benefit tremendously. As you become fitter, exercise will become easier and each time you will use less energy. If you stick to the same old workout routine you may be at a loss.

You need a workout program that steadily increases the pressure to keep burning fat. that workout program needs a different workout everyday for at least three days a week.

Starting with 2 sets per exercise and in each successive being burned by the end of your workout.week an additional set for each exercise.

If you exercise that way,your metabolic rate will increase and result in more calories per hour being burned by the end of your workout.

Many people are of the notion that over-the-counter diet remedies(e.g teas and pills) will solve their obesity problems. But no, these miracle cures are only advertised to make the manufacturer's wallets fatter.

The idea is to change your eating habits, meaning, eat more protein and less fat. That means, eat less of the butter, the meats an the cheese among others. Furthermore, instead of eating three square meals a day, eat smaller portions of food throughout the day.

It is alright to eat dessert, but do not be a glutton! It is not about eating less, but about eating sensibly.

 

Here are some tips to burning fat:

1) Eat more- eat several times a day and you will boost your metabolism thus burning more calories through digestion. Of course eat meals that are high in protein and rich in fibre.

2) Do not eat before bedtime- No eating after 7pm or rather do not eat three hours before bedtime.

You should not eat late because that encourages gas and prevents proper digestion of food. Besides late eating may cause your stomach to cramp and bloating. Moreover, if you eat late you may tend to get up tired. That is because when your body has to rest it has to fight to get your food digested during the night.

3) Don't eat for comfort- Some people eat when they are stressed. Stress causes an increase of cortisol and can cause you to get fat. Drink water instead. Sometimes, during depression you might think you are hungry but actually you are simply using food as a form of comfort. Stress and weight loss are not a good combination.

4) Cut down on salt- Be careful with the amount of salt you put into your system. Sometimes you can consume too much salt through packaged and canned foods. Use less of pre-packaged foods. Eat fruits instead or cook your own dinner. besides too much salt can lead to hypertension.

5) Cut down on the mayonnaise- Too much salad dressing could also be a problem so be careful.

 

All in all, be mindful of the way you eat and how you eat. A heavy breakfast, a light lunch and an even lighter supper will suffice in most cases if you truly want to lose weight.
